Decoding the Product Label

The most direct and reliable method to determine if a collagen supplement is hydrolyzed is by carefully reading the product label. Manufacturers of high-quality, bioavailable collagen proudly display this information to attract informed consumers. Key terms are your primary indicators.

Look for Key Terminology

  • Hydrolyzed Collagen: This is the most straightforward term to find. It explicitly states that the product has undergone the hydrolysis process, breaking down the large collagen molecules into smaller amino acid chains.
  • Collagen Peptides: Often used interchangeably with hydrolyzed collagen, "peptides" indicates that the protein has been broken down into small, digestible fragments. Many brands favor this term for its scientific precision.
  • Collagen Hydrolysate: This is another technical term that means the same thing. Seeing this on a label confirms that the product consists of smaller, more absorbable collagen molecules.

Scrutinize the Ingredients List

Always check the ingredients section on the back or side of the package. Some product fronts may use marketing jargon, but the ingredients list is legally required to be more precise. Look for one of the terms listed above. A pure hydrolyzed product will often list only "hydrolyzed collagen (bovine)," "marine collagen peptides," or a similar formulation.

The Practicality Test: The Cold Water Challenge

Beyond the label, the physical properties of the powder itself can be a clear giveaway. A simple test with a glass of cold water can distinguish hydrolyzed collagen from its non-hydrolyzed counterpart, gelatin.

The Cold Water Test

  1. Take a scoop of the collagen powder.
  2. Add it to a glass of cold water or another cold liquid.
  3. Stir gently.

Hydrolyzed collagen powder is highly soluble due to its low molecular weight. It should dissolve quickly and completely into the cold liquid without any clumping or gelling. If the powder forms clumps or a thick, gel-like consistency in cold water, you are likely dealing with gelatin, which requires hot liquid to dissolve.

The Scientific Clue: Molecular Weight

For those who want to be absolutely certain of their product's quality, some manufacturers list the molecular weight of their collagen peptides. This technical detail offers a glimpse into the degree of hydrolysis the product has undergone.

Why Size Matters

The native, triple-helix collagen molecule is large, with a molecular weight of around 300 kDa. This size makes it difficult for the body to absorb efficiently. Through hydrolysis, this large molecule is broken down into smaller peptides, typically with a molecular weight between 3–6 kDa. The lower the molecular weight, the easier and more effectively the body can absorb and utilize the collagen peptides, leading to faster, more noticeable results.

Look for Molecular Weight Specifications

Check the packaging or the manufacturer's website for molecular weight information. Reputable brands often provide this data to highlight their product's superior bioavailability. If the molecular weight is very low (e.g., 2,000 Daltons), it indicates a higher degree of hydrolysis and potentially better absorption.

A Comparison: Hydrolyzed vs. Non-Hydrolyzed Collagen

Understanding the differences between the forms of collagen is crucial for making an informed purchase. The table below highlights the key distinctions.

Feature Hydrolyzed Collagen (Peptides) Non-Hydrolyzed Collagen (Gelatin)
Molecular Size Small, broken-down peptides (3–6 kDa) Large, intact protein chains (approx. 300 kDa)
Absorption Rate High, up to 90% Low, less efficient
Solubility in Cold Liquid Dissolves completely Gels and clumps
Digestibility Easy to digest Harder on the stomach
Taste & Odor Neutral, virtually tasteless Can have a noticeable flavor and odor
Typical Uses Supplements (powders, capsules), sports recovery drinks Gelling agent (jello, gummies), thickener in hot foods

Additional Indicators of Quality

While checking for the term "hydrolyzed" is the main step, other quality signals can help you select the best supplement.

Check the Sourcing

  • Marine Collagen: Sourced from fish, often from wild-caught species. Known for being high in Type I collagen, beneficial for skin health.
  • Bovine Collagen: Sourced from cows, typically from hides and bones. Rich in Type I and III, supporting skin, hair, and muscles.
  • Chicken Collagen: Sourced from chicken cartilage and rich in Type II collagen, making it particularly beneficial for joint health.

Look for Third-Party Certifications

Reputable brands often seek third-party testing to verify purity and potency. Look for certifications that assure the product is free from heavy metals, contaminants, and unnecessary fillers. This transparency builds consumer trust and confidence in the product's quality.
